Main Applications
This compound is a high-value heterocyclic building block widely used in fine chemical synthesis, with core applications in pharmaceutical and agrochemical R&D and industrial production. As a key intermediate, it is widely used in the synthesis of targeted anticancer, anti-inflammatory, and broad-spectrum antimicrobial drugs, providing a stable thiazole core structure for active pharmaceutical ingredients (APIs) and optimizing the binding affinity of drug molecules with biological targets, effectively improving metabolic stability and in vivo bioavailability of drug derivatives. In the agrochemical field, it is a critical precursor for high-efficiency fungicides and insecticides, acting on the fungal melanin biosynthesis pathway to inhibit pathogen growth and reproduction, with low toxicity to non-target crops and environmental friendliness, widely used in crop protection formulations. Meanwhile, it serves as a versatile organic synthesis intermediate, providing a reliable structural platform for the construction of complex heterocyclic compounds, widely used in academic research and industrial scale-up synthesis of functional chemicals, and can be used as a precursor for the preparation of fluorescent probes and material additives with special optical properties.
Safety & Storage Handling
This chemical is a general industrial organic chemical, non-hazardous for road transport, but strict safe handling rules must be followed in all operation scenarios. It is a moderate irritant to human skin, eyes and respiratory mucosa, long-term skin contact may cause redness, itching and allergic inflammation, inhalation of aerosol or vapor will irritate the respiratory tract, causing cough, throat discomfort and short-term respiratory irritation, accidental ingestion will stimulate the digestive tract mucosa and cause gastrointestinal discomfort. It has no acute high toxicity to human body, but long-term repeated exposure without protection may cause chronic local irritation, and it has low aquatic toxicity, which will cause short-term stress to aquatic microorganisms when directly discharged into water body, so it is forbidden to directly discharge waste liquid into water system or sewer. For storage, it must be sealed in a dry, cool and light-proof container, kept away from strong oxidants, strong acids and alkalis to avoid chemical decomposition and side reactions, and stored in a special ventilated chemical storage cabinet. In operation, complete personal protection including goggles, chemical-resistant gloves and respirator is required, and the operation area must be kept well ventilated. In case of accidental contact, rinse the contaminated area with plenty of clean water immediately and seek medical advice if irritation persists.
